Happy Earth Day: Most games now cost less than a tank of gas

by PJ Hruschak on Apr 22, 2008 at 07:54 PM

gamertell earth day 2008 gas prices

It’s Earth Day 2008 (April 22, 2008) and the average price of gas around my town (near Cincinnati, Ohio) has finally reached $3.60 per gallon. That means a 14-gallon fill-up now costs $50.40. Yep, the price of the average console videogame.

Which will you try to spend less on, games or gas? Will gamers across the country buy one less game a year to have enough money to drive to work one extra week?

Consider this: Staying home and playing videogames means less time on the road which translates into less time quickly consuming automobile fuel (and polluting)...

Capcom polls gamers for Bionic Commando Rearmed price

by Richard Snyder on Feb 24, 2008 at 03:09 PM

That guy in the middle looks like Ken.

Capcom has put up a poll Tuesday (February 19, 2008) on their official North American Bionic Commando site that anyone faintly interested in downloading Bionic Commando Rearmed, the souped-up remake of the classic NES title headed for the XBox 360, Playstation3 and PC, should probably vote in: whether to price the game at $10 or $15.

Supposedly, this is really to settle an argument between…
